Zvládejte vstupní soubory LaTeXu ze souborových systémů v Javě

Úvod

Pokud se noříte do světa vývoje v Javě a potřebujete efektivně zacházet se vstupními soubory LaTeX ze souborových systémů, jste na správném místě. Tento podrobný průvodce vás provede procesem pomocí Aspose.TeX, výkonné Java knihovny navržené pro práci se soubory TeX a LaTeX.

Předpoklady

Než začneme, ujistěte se, že máte splněny následující předpoklady:

  1. Aspose.TeX for Java: Stáhněte a nainstalujte knihovnu ztady.
  2. Licence: Ujistěte se, že máte platnou licenci k používání Aspose.TeX. Můžete získat dočasnou licencitady.
  3. Pracovní adresář: Nastavte pracovní adresáře pro vstupní i výstupní soubory.

Importujte balíčky

Do svého projektu Java naimportujte potřebné balíčky pro práci s Aspose.TeX. Na začátek souboru Java přidejte následující řádky:

package com.aspose.tex.LaTeXRequiredInputFs;

import java.io.IOException;

import com.aspose.tex.InputFileSystemDirectory;
import com.aspose.tex.OutputFileSystemDirectory;
import com.aspose.tex.TeXConfig;
import com.aspose.tex.TeXJob;
import com.aspose.tex.TeXOptions;
import com.aspose.tex.rendering.ImageDevice;
import com.aspose.tex.rendering.PngSaveOptions;

import util.Utils;

Nyní si příklad rozdělíme do několika kroků pro jasné pochopení.

Krok 1: Nastavte licenci

Ujistěte se, že je vaše aplikace správně licencována přidáním následujícího řádku:

Utils.setLicense();

Krok 2: Nakonfigurujte možnosti převodu

Vytvořte možnosti převodu pro formát Object LaTeX pomocí rozšíření enginu TeX:

TeXOptions options = TeXOptions.consoleAppOptions(TeXConfig.objectLaTeX());

Krok 3: Zadejte výstupní pracovní adresář

Nastavte výstupní pracovní adresář pro převedené soubory:

options.setOutputWorkingDirectory(new OutputFileSystemDirectory("Your Output Directory"));

Krok 4: Zadejte pracovní adresář vstupu

Definujte adresář obsahující balíčky pro požadovaný vstup:

options.setRequiredInputDirectory(new InputFileSystemDirectory("Your Input Directory" + "packages"));

Krok 5: Inicializujte možnosti uložení

Inicializujte možnosti pro ukládání ve formátu PNG:

options.setSaveOptions(new PngSaveOptions());

Krok 6: Spusťte konverzi

Spusťte převod LaTeXu na PNG pomocí zadaných možností:

new TeXJob("Your Input Directory" + "required-input-fs.tex", new ImageDevice(), options).run();

Gratulujeme! Úspěšně jste zpracovali LaTeXové vstupní soubory ze souborových systémů v Javě pomocí Aspose.TeX.

Závěr

V tomto tutoriálu jsme prozkoumali bezproblémovou integraci Aspose.TeX pro Javu pro práci se vstupními soubory LaTeXu. Knihovna poskytuje robustní funkce, což z ní činí nezbytný nástroj pro vývojáře v Javě pracující s TeXem a LaTeXem.

FAQ

Q1: Kde najdu dokumentaci Aspose.TeX?

A1: Dokumentace je k dispozicitady.

Q2: Jak si mohu stáhnout Aspose.TeX pro Javu?

A2: Můžete si to stáhnouttady.

Q3: Kde mohu získat podporu pro Aspose.TeX?

A3: Navštivte fórum podporytady.

Q4: Je k dispozici bezplatná zkušební verze?

A4: Ano, můžete získat bezplatnou zkušební verzitady.

Q5: Jak mohu zakoupit Aspose.TeX?

A5: Možnosti nákupu jsou k dispozicitady.